QUOTE(ziggy87 @ Jul 6 2009, 09:05 PM)
no discussion of hack please..
i don't want this thread to get banned sweat.gif
menu >> tools >> settings >> general >> positioning >> positioning methods
then you can see whether Assisted GPS is enabled or not (ticked or no tick)

i heard they charge 8 cents everytime AGPS is activated
*
ohh... yes, A-GPS has been enable. and i've disable it and try just now with integrated GPS. yes it works no different from A-GPS which i tried both of them. when i'm under a highway bridge it will lost signal for a moment and it connect back very quick once it detected a signal. very impressive thumbup.gif

another solution for this which i had try is HARD RESET IT by
HOLD button "CALL" & "*" & "3" for second or two and then while holding press the power OFF button
after the phone is off
same thing HOLD button "CALL" & "*" & "3" for second or two and then while holding press the power ON button till you see the hand shake is out can release it.

Take your time setting up your phone back laugh.gif

After i done this my phone so far touch wood so good lar...no hang ady so frequent. 1-2day usage this few days is good, no hand at all thumbup.gif
